Compartilhar via


WebAssemblyHostConfiguration Classe

Definição

WebAssemblyHostConfiguration é uma classe que implementa a interface de IConfiguration, IConfigurationRoot e IConfigurationBuilder. Ele pode ser usado para compilar e ler de forma simulada um objeto de configuração.

public ref class WebAssemblyHostConfiguration : Microsoft::Extensions::Configuration::IConfigurationBuilder, Microsoft::Extensions::Configuration::IConfigurationRoot
public class WebAssemblyHostConfiguration : Microsoft.Extensions.Configuration.IConfigurationBuilder, Microsoft.Extensions.Configuration.IConfigurationRoot
type WebAssemblyHostConfiguration = class
    interface IConfiguration
    interface IConfigurationRoot
    interface IConfigurationBuilder
Public Class WebAssemblyHostConfiguration
Implements IConfigurationBuilder, IConfigurationRoot
Herança
WebAssemblyHostConfiguration
Implementações

Construtores

WebAssemblyHostConfiguration()

WebAssemblyHostConfiguration é uma classe que implementa a interface de IConfiguration, IConfigurationRoot e IConfigurationBuilder. Ele pode ser usado para compilar e ler de forma simulada um objeto de configuração.

Propriedades

Item[String]

WebAssemblyHostConfiguration é uma classe que implementa a interface de IConfiguration, IConfigurationRoot e IConfigurationBuilder. Ele pode ser usado para compilar e ler de forma simulada um objeto de configuração.

Métodos

Add(IConfigurationSource)

Adiciona uma nova fonte de configuração, recupera o provedor para a origem e adiciona um ouvinte de alteração que dispara uma recarga do provedor sempre que uma alteração é detectada.

Build()

Compila um IConfiguration com chaves e valores do conjunto de provedores registrados no Providers.

Dispose()

WebAssemblyHostConfiguration é uma classe que implementa a interface de IConfiguration, IConfigurationRoot e IConfigurationBuilder. Ele pode ser usado para compilar e ler de forma simulada um objeto de configuração.

GetReloadToken()

Retorna um IChangeToken que pode ser usado para observar quando essa configuração é recarregada.

GetSection(String)

Obtém uma subseção de configuração com a chave especificada.

Reload()

Força os valores de configuração a serem recarregados das fontes subjacentes.

Implantações explícitas de interface

IConfiguration.GetChildren()

Obtém as subseções de configuração de descendente imediato.

IConfigurationBuilder.Properties

Obtém uma coleção chave/valor que pode ser usada para compartilhar dados entre as IConfigurationBuilder instâncias registradas IConfigurationProvider e .

IConfigurationBuilder.Sources

Obtém as fontes usadas para obter valores de configuração.

IConfigurationRoot.Providers

Obtém os provedores usados para obter valores de configuração.

Aplica-se a